Description: 28lt Nano Fluval 3 running Alfagrog E25 Saltwater natural ocean tank. All collected from local sources just palaemon serratus ready for the bass fishing when needed. However they look so gorgeous and I will find it hard to put a hook on them.
Advice: Get advice and take it slow, ensuring to cycle your setup before adding anything.
